Fp. gardneri nigerianus Akamkpa Dark Morph
Hi Jay!
I finally got around to looking at your photos
of your "dark" morph of gar. Akampha. This
dark morph has the same coloration and
intensity of an F1 strain of Akampa ( spelling
at the time) that I got from Germany in the
middle 1980's. In fact, it looks more like the
Akampa that I was familiar with, than its tank-
mates in the picture.( does this make the pale
colored Akampas "light morph" if I keep them
again since I was used to the dark kind being
the normal variety?
It might interest you to know that the F1 that
I had produced absolutely beautiful lyretails for
a period. I have a slide of one of the lyretails
in my slide collection. I entered the lyretail in
one of the AKA conventions and it brought a
considerable amount of money at the time for
a gardneri!
By the way, I still like gardneri and I currently
have four strains: Lokoja, Misaje, Jos-Plateau
and Mamfense-Ossing.
